Key Responsibilities include, but are not limited to
- Responsible for screening work orders, identification of scope, analysis of required level of planning and overall scheduling of maintenance activities given available resources, criticality of work, and available maintenance windows
- Perform equipment quality audits to identify and document job requirement
- Identify specific safety hazards associated with planned maintenance activities
- Estimate required work hours associated with work order tasks and total work duration
- Plan parts and materials for reliability improvement projects in order to maximize technician wrench time, improve efficiency, increase system reliability and performance
- Ensure all work orders and maintenance activities are derived from EAM and accurately closed out in the system in accordance with Amazon's maintenance virtuous cycle
- Compile equipment information into a job package that is ready for technicians to accomplish each shift; clearly communicate the critical steps in the work process
- Collect necessary engineering drawings, technical documents and specifications
- Analyze equipment downtime data and develop & manage a warranty process that will drive OEM uptime and lower cost
- Drive a proactive maintenance program that ensure 85% of planned work is proactive
- Partner with local Reliability Maintenance and Engineering leadership groups to coordinate maintenance activities in support of driving a World Class Maintenance organization
- Own and regularly respond with subject matter expertise to maintenance/equipment related questions, own access to and distribution of OEM technical bulletin updates, and facilitate strong communication with OEM vendors
